Job Description

Program Design & Curation:

  • Develop student personas to enable curated opportunity recommendations.
  • Design and maintain a comprehensive "leadership menu" of curated opportunities tailored to student personas.
  • Develop segmentation models that match students to relevant programs, convenings, and experiences.

Campus Partnership & Training:

  • Equip Springboard Fellows and campus engagement staff to deliver persona-based leadership support locally.
  • Coordinate with campus teams to ensure seamless student handoffs and consistent follow-through.
  • Provide ongoing support through biweekly check-ins and proactive outreach.

Data Management & Reporting:

  • In partnership with campus partners, maintain accurate, up-to-date records in Hillel's CRM system for all student interactions and outcomes.
  • Generate reports for leadership demonstrating program impact and areas for improvement.
  • Use data insights to continuously refine personas, curation strategies, and engagement approaches.

About Hillel International

Hillel International enriches the lives of Jewish students and is the largest Jewish campus organization in the world, present at nearly 1,000 colleges and universities across North America and around the world. Their mission is to create lasting connections with every Jewish student and train them to become the next Jewish leaders.
